Transaction 7f86095655669177c820754c080a4d0f73745787ce1731c4abed2094f2a5ed0a
1 Input
1 Output
-
7f86095655669177c820754c080a4d0f73745787ce1731c4abed2094f2a5ed0a:0
- value
- 144945
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c64c355de93d1e85016c43d0d0d6d030cec5a565 OP_EQUAL
- address
- 3KmX1amoMhghue6pXrYCJoq9ozzLxkR16p